About Satawariya Village
Satawariya is a mid sized village in Masuda tehsil, in the district of Ajmer, Rajasthan.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,709, made up of 856 males and 853 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 996 females per 1000 males. The village covers 1038.58 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 305623,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Satawariya
The census records public bus service for Satawariya as Available within village.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
